Abstract
Ever-growing penetration of wind energy conversion systems (WECS) into the grid, has made their continuous operation compulsory, even during sudden dips in the grid voltage. Also, they should deliver reactive power for better voltage recovery during the voltage dip. This capability of remaining connected and supporting reactive power to the grid during a sudden voltage dip, is defined as low voltage ride through (LVRT). Various international grid codes have been introduced on LVRT of grid-connected WECS, to maintain the power system stability. Doubly fed induction generators (DFIGs) are extensively used in high and medium power WECS applications, due to its several advantages. But the DFIG, is very much grid-sensitive, due to the presence of a direct link between DFIG-stator and the grid. So, along with the development of DFIG-WECS, a comprehensive understanding of proper LVRT topology selection, is also becoming much important. In this paper, various external configuration based LVRT solutions for DFIG, are compared in MATLAB / Simulink environment.
